The 1979 Gold Krugerrand symbolises South Africa's rich gold mining legacy and its global impact on bullion trade.
Introduced in 1967, the Krugerrand was pivotal in popularising gold investment among private individuals, showcasing the nation's economic strength. Paul Kruger, a prominent Boer leader and statesman, served as President of the South African Republic (Transvaal). He represented Afrikaner nationalism during resistance against British imperialism.
Obverse: Paul Kruger
Reverse: Springbok
